Large language models prioritize Western morals, potentially misjudging other cultures. They reflect Western values in advice and language.
Large language models, such as ChatGPT, have been found to prioritize Western moral values, often misjudging what people outside the West might value as a moral priority. This discovery highlights a significant cultural bias in AI, where models reflect mainly Western values while overlooking those important in other cultures. This matters because AI models like ChatGPT are increasingly used globally, providing advice and language that may not be suitable or respectful of local cultures. The risk of cultural bias is real, and it assumes that the whole world should pursue the same values as the West. This oversight can have significant implications for users from diverse cultural backgrounds.
What to watch next is how AI developers and researchers address this cultural bias. Will they prioritize diverse value systems and work towards creating more inclusive language models? The recent research published in the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ences is a step towards acknowledging the issue, and it remains to be seen how the industry will respond to these findings.
